About the role

Here at Teaching Personnel, we are seeking a motivated and professional qualified Science Teacher to join one of our partner secondary schools in Smethwick. This is an excellent opportunity for a dedicated teacher who is passionate about Science and committed to helping students achieve their full potential.

Responsibilities
  • Deliver engaging and well-structured Science lessons across Biology, Chemistry, and Physics at Key Stages 3 and 4
  • Prepare students for GCSE Science examinations, ensuring lessons are aligned with the UK National Curriculum and exam board specifications
  • Use practical experiments, demonstrations, and interactive teaching methods to bring scientific concepts to life
  • Support pupils of varying abilities, encouraging curiosity and critical thinking in the subject
  • Plan, prepare, and assess work in line with school policies, ensuring high standards of teaching and learning
  • Contribute to extracurricular science activities, clubs, or enrichment opportunities where possible
What we’re looking for
  •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) or equivalent
  • Strong subject knowledge across Biology, Chemistry and Physics, with the ability to specialise in at least one discipline
  • Experience preparing pupils for GCSE Science examinations (desirable)
  • A motivated, professional and proactive attitude with a passion for inspiring students in STEM
  • Experience teaching Science in a secondary school setting (desirable but not essential)
